Here DeBakey chronicled his first visit to the Soviet Union December 15-20, 1958, where he attended a surgical conference and learned more about the state of surgical practice there. Despite the Cold War, DeBakey reached out to his colleagues in the USSR several times, to foster educational exchange as much as he could. In the 1990s, after the collapse of the Soviet Union, he was asked to advise surgeons about the health of Russian president Boris Yeltsin.
